What Happened
Larsen & Toubro's Metals & Minerals division has won several 'mega' orders from both government and private companies. These include projects for an iron ore handling plant, a steel plant expansion, and a new zinc processing facility. This signifies a strong inflow of new business for L&T.

Key Evidence
- L&T's Metals & Minerals business secured multiple 'mega' orders.
- Contracts are from leading domestic public and private sector companies.
- One order involves an 18-MTPA iron ore handling plant in Chhattisgarh.
- Another project expands a steel plant in West Bengal significantly.
- L&T also won an EPC order for a new zinc processing plant.
